You are doing two experiments:
- Experiment 1 is successful with probability 2/3 and fails with probability 1/3.
- Experiment 2 is successful with probability 4/5 and fails with probability 1/5.
- The results of these two experiments are independent of each other.
Determine the probability that both experiments fail.
